Blau-Weis Linz were up against Floridsdorfer AC in the 1 Liga of Austria on May 5. The match ended in a 1-1 deadlock after an evenly contested game.
On the 45th minute, Ronivaldo netted the first goal of the match, putting Blau-Weis Linz in front. This was followed by a goal from Christian Bubalovic, concluding at 1-1.

Blau-Weis Linz kicked off the game with Nicolas Schmid, Manuel Maranda, Simon Pirkl, Christoph Schosswendter who got substituted by Marco Krainz on the 90th minute, Fabio Strauss who got substituted by Danilo Mitrovic on the 62nd minute, Fabian Windhager who got substituted by Julian Golles on the 46th minute, Michael Brandner, Tobias Koch, Matthias Seidl who got substituted by Paul Mensah on the 77th minute, Fally Mayulu and Ronivaldo as starters, with Felix Gschossmann, Julian Golles, Danilo Mitrovic, Jahn Herrmann, Marco Krainz, Simon Seidl and Paul Mensah on the bench.
Floridsdorfer AC's starting eleven were Simon Emil Spari, Mirnes Becirovic, Christian Bubalovic, Marcus Maier, Alexander Mankowski who got substituted by Masse Scherzadeh on the 46th minute, Benjamin Wallquist, Leomend Krasniqi who got substituted by Oluwaseun Adewumi on the 80th minute, Flavio who got substituted by Clemens Hubmann on the 90th minute, Eren Keles who got substituted by Vice Miljanic on the 65th minute, Christopher Krohn who got substituted by Paolino Bertaccini on the 65th minute and Marcel Monsberger, with Mathias Gindl, Thomas Fink, Clemens Hubmann, Masse Scherzadeh, Oluwaseun Adewumi, Paolino Bertaccini and Vice Miljanic on the bench.

Referee showed the yellow card five times throughout the game. Marcel Monsberger, Benjamin Wallquist, Julian Golles, Christian Bubalovic and Clemens Hubmann were the ones to receive it.
Over five meetings since November 2020, the teams have each had their moments. Blau-Weis Linz have won once while Floridsdorfer have won four times. The most recent match between them was on October 2, 2022, in the 1 Liga of Austria, where Floridsdorfer secured a 2-1 victory. Across these five head-to-head matches, Blau-Weis Linz have scored four goals, while Floridsdorfer have netted ten. Overall, Floridsdorfer AC hold a stronger head-to-head record against Blau-Weis Linz in recent meetings.
